How Affordable Are Small Electric Two-Seaters Really?

When most people think of electric vehicles, Tesla’s premium prices often come to mind first. However, the small two-seater electric car market offers significantly more budget-friendly options. Many of these compact EVs start at prices between $20,000 and $30,000 before incentives—comparable to many economy gas vehicles.

Federal tax credits of up to $7,500 can bring the effective price down substantially, and many states offer additional incentives ranging from $1,000 to $5,000. When factored together with dramatically lower operating costs, these vehicles become even more affordable. The average owner saves approximately $800-1,200 annually on fuel costs alone compared to gas vehicles, with additional savings of $300-500 on maintenance due to fewer moving parts and no oil changes.

Insurance costs for these smaller vehicles also tend to be lower than for larger EVs, contributing to even more cost savings over the vehicle’s lifetime.

What Makes Small Electric Cars Perfect for City Driving?

Small two-seater EVs excel in urban environments where their compact dimensions become a significant advantage. With typical lengths under 10 feet for many models, these vehicles can fit into parking spaces that would be impossible for conventional cars. Their tight turning radius—often under 30 feet—makes navigating narrow city streets and executing U-turns remarkably easy.

The instant torque delivery characteristic of electric motors provides quick acceleration from a standstill, perfect for stop-and-go traffic conditions. This responsiveness, combined with their small footprint, allows drivers to confidently maneuver through congested urban areas, changing lanes with ease and slipping into tight spots that larger vehicles would have to pass by.

Additionally, many municipalities offer free or discounted parking for electric vehicles, along with access to HOV lanes regardless of passenger count—benefits that significantly enhance the daily driving experience in metropolitan areas.

What Range and Charging Options Do These Vehicles Offer?

Small two-seater electric cars typically offer ranges between 80-150 miles on a single charge. While this might seem limited compared to larger EVs, it exceeds the average daily commute in America (about 40 miles round trip) by a considerable margin.

Charging infrastructure has improved dramatically in recent years. Most models can charge from a standard 120V household outlet (Level 1 charging), adding about 3-5 miles of range per hour—sufficient for overnight charging to cover daily commuting needs. Level 2 chargers (240V), which can be installed at home for $500-1,500, charge at rates of 20-30 miles per hour, fully replenishing the battery in 3-5 hours.

For longer journeys, many newer models are compatible with DC fast charging stations, which can restore 80% of the battery capacity in 30-60 minutes. The expanding network of public charging stations—now exceeding 50,000 locations nationwide—makes these vehicles increasingly practical beyond city limits.

Which Top Models Offer the Best Features and Value?

Several standout models in the small two-seater electric vehicle market offer impressive features and value:

The Smart EQ fortwo leads with its ultra-compact dimensions (8.8 feet long) and city-friendly 22.8-foot turning circle. Its 58-mile range is aimed squarely at urban use, with a surprising amount of cargo space (8.9 cubic feet) despite its tiny footprint.

The Fiat 500e combines Italian design with practicality, offering a 100-mile range, zippy acceleration (0-60 in about 9 seconds), and a more premium interior feel than many competitors. Its retro styling makes it one of the most visually appealing options in the segment.

For those seeking more range, the Mini Cooper SE provides approximately 114 miles per charge with the brand’s signature handling characteristics. Though technically a 2+2 configuration, the rear seats are best suited for occasional use or additional storage.

Emerging options from Chinese manufacturers are beginning to enter the market with even lower price points, such as the Wuling Hongguang Mini EV, which has been a massive success in Asia and may eventually reach American shores with prices potentially starting under $15,000.

How Do These Small EVs Impact the Environment?

The environmental benefits of small two-seater electric vehicles extend beyond their zero tailpipe emissions. Their compact size requires fewer raw materials during manufacturing, and their lightweight design contributes to exceptional energy efficiency—typically 3-4 miles per kWh compared to 2-3 miles per kWh for larger EVs.

Over a vehicle’s lifetime, small electric cars produce approximately 50-70% fewer greenhouse gas emissions than comparable gas vehicles, even when accounting for electricity generation. In states with cleaner electrical grids, this advantage becomes even more pronounced.

Additionally, these vehicles’ batteries are increasingly recyclable, with modern recycling processes able to recover up to 95% of key materials like lithium, cobalt, and nickel. Several manufacturers now offer battery recycling programs, further reducing the environmental footprint.

How Do Small Two-Seater EVs Compare in Real-World Costs?


Model Starting Price (Before Incentives) Est. Annual Energy Cost Est. Range
Smart EQ fortwo $25,000 $450 58 miles
Fiat 500e $29,900 $500 100 miles
Mini Cooper SE $30,750 $550 114 miles
Nissan Leaf (for comparison) $28,375 $600 149 miles
Chevrolet Bolt (for comparison) $26,500 $550 259 miles

Prices, rates, or cost estimates mentioned in this article are based on the latest available information but may change over time. Independent research is advised before making financial decisions.

When factoring in available incentives, the true cost of ownership becomes even more appealing. Federal tax credits can reduce prices by up to $7,500, while state incentives may add another $1,000-5,000 in savings. Maintenance costs average 30-40% lower than combustion vehicles over a five-year period, with fewer parts to replace and no oil changes required.

Charging at home during off-peak hours can further reduce operating costs, with an average cost of 3-5 cents per mile compared to 10-15 cents per mile for gasoline vehicles at current fuel prices.
